SKIFF Trip #6 of the 2015 Season — The Darsam Boys

This morning I conducted the sixth SKIFF trip of the 2015 season, taking Evan (age 10) and Johnny (age 8) Darsam, accompanied by their Uncle James, out on Stillhouse Hollow for a morning of fishing.

From left: Johnny Darsam, Uncle James, and Evan Darsam with the best of the bunch of fish we caught today on a combination of downrigging in open water and slipfloat fishing in shallow water.

SKIFF (Soldiers’ Kids Involved in Fishing Fun) trips are provided free of charge to families whose children are separated from a parent due to that parent’s military service, thanks to the Austin Fly Fishers and a network of supportive individuals from all over the U.S.  All it takes is a phone call from a parent to me at 254-368-7411 to reserve a date.
 With their father just recently deployed near the end of the school year, the boys’ mom, Jenn Darsam, decided to take advantage of every summertime program she could find in order to fill the boys’ schedule so none of them had time to sit around and sulk and dwell on dad’s absence.
We enjoyed 45 minutes of solid white bass action on downriggers worked over 35 feet of water until this area dried up on us.  We looked over another open water area for white bass and found little there.  To avoid any long fishless spells, I opted at this point to break out the bream poles, and we went to work up shallow catching sunfish on livebait under slipfloats.  Later, we gave largemouth bass fishing a try on livebait over deep hydrilla, but struck out on that.  We wrapped up with one more unsuccessful shot at downrigging for whites bass, and, in order to end on a strong note, finished up shallow in pursued of the ever-willing bluegill.
The boys boated exactly 37 fish today.

 

TALLY = 37 FISH, all caught and released

TODAY’S CONDITIONS/NOTES:

Start Time: 6:45a

End Time:  11:00a

Air Temp. @ Trip’s Start:  77F

Water Surface Temp:  83.4F

Wind Speed & Direction: SSW11-14

Sky Conditions:  80%  cloud cover.

Note: Lake has dropped 0.08 feet in the last 24 hours and now stands at 623.29 above sea level, with 622.00 being full pool
